## Releases

Validrail ships as a core runtime plus versioned validator plugins. Reviewers: confirm that any plugin touching the schema registry bumps its major version, since the loader refuses mismatched contracts at startup. Release candidates are built by the Ostermere pipeline, and changelog entries must reference the plugin manifest diff. Nothing merges to `release` without two approvals. Every published plugin archive is signed so the loader can verify provenance, and the release pipeline performs that signing with the key below.

signing key of baduf-taweg = bky6_Zf7bem

Subject: Badge System Migration — Action Needed

Dear team assistants,

As part of the move from the Gatefern system to Lockspur at Arrowhithe Plaza, all existing badges will stop working on Friday evening. Please collect replacement badges for your teams from the front desk before 16:00 Thursday. Until each new badge is activated, the lobby turnstiles accept the interim code below.

door code, yagap-bahof: bdg-O-05

Ticket #FN-882 — Vault locked, notification fan-out backpressure

For the weekly sync: the Driftbell fan-out service hit sustained backpressure Tuesday, and its rate-limit vault locked after repeated token refresh failures. Downstream consumers are fine; publishers are queuing. Plan is to unseal the vault, replay the backlog at half rate, then raise throughput gradually while watching consumer lag. Unseal requires the recovery passphrase below.

vault phrase of bagaf-kajeg = jorath-feniel-briir-siliel-ralix

### Capacity Note: Veylith GPU Profiler

For this week's sync: the Veylith memory profiler now samples allocations on all training pods at Orrinbrook. Overhead stays under two percent at current sampling rates, but snapshot retention is filling the scratch volume faster than projected. We propose trimming retention and capping snapshot size before scaling to the new cluster. The proposed tuning constants appear below.

tuning constants:
QUOTAS = {
    "druwyn": 5,
    "holix": 5,
    "zorath": 5,
    "holwyn": 10,
}